Poker: The Art of Deception and Calculation
Poker, particularly variants like Texas Hold’em and Omaha, demands more than just a strong hand. It requires a mastery of reading opponents, understanding betting patterns, and employing psychological tactics. Advanced players analyze their opponents’ tendencies, recognizing tells and exploiting weaknesses. They understand the importance of position, pot odds, and implied odds. Furthermore, they are adept at bluffing, semi-bluffing, and value betting to maximize their profits. Mastering poker also involves disciplined bankroll management. Knowing when to play, when to fold, and when to move up or down in stakes is crucial for long-term sustainability. Tournament play presents its own set of challenges, requiring players to adjust their strategies based on the tournament structure, blind levels, and the number of remaining players.
Blackjack: Card Counting and Strategic Play
Blackjack, often perceived as a game of luck, offers opportunities for strategic advantage. While card counting is a controversial tactic, it remains a viable strategy for skilled players. However, it requires significant practice, mental agility, and the ability to remain undetected. Even without card counting, advanced blackjack players utilize basic strategy charts to make optimal decisions based on their hand and the dealer’s up card. They understand the importance of splitting pairs, doubling down, and managing their bankroll effectively. They also know the rules variations, such as surrender options and the number of decks used, which can significantly impact the house edge.
Sports Betting: The Pursuit of Value
Sports betting, unlike casino games, involves analyzing a vast amount of data and understanding the nuances of various sports. Successful sports bettors are not just fans; they are analysts. They research team statistics, player performance, injury reports, and even weather conditions. They seek out value bets, identifying discrepancies between the odds offered by bookmakers and their own assessment of the probability of an outcome. They also employ disciplined bankroll management, setting limits on their bets and avoiding the temptation to chase losses. Advanced sports bettors often specialize in particular sports or leagues, allowing them to develop a deeper understanding and gain an edge over the bookmakers.
Risk Management and Bankroll Preservation
Regardless of the game, effective risk management is the cornerstone of long-term success. Experienced gamblers understand that losses are inevitable, and they have strategies in place to mitigate their impact. This includes:
- Setting Limits: Establishing pre-defined limits on both wins and losses. Knowing when to walk away is as crucial as knowing when to play.
- Bankroll Management: Allocating a specific bankroll for gambling and dividing it into smaller units for individual bets.
- Diversification: Spreading bets across different games or sports to reduce overall risk.
- Avoiding Emotional Decisions: Making rational decisions based on strategy, not emotion.
